My Capital One Quick Silver (which was product changed from the original Platinum) was just product changed to the Venture One.
For all reading this, the card just surpassed the one year mark.
I did not see for either move any notification in my account from Capital One. What I did was accessed my account, clicked on the "credit card" (because I have a checking account - the Capital One 360 Checking) and simply added the /productupgrade at the end (up in the address bar, after the "="). This is a well known way to check with Capital One if your card has any available upgrades or product changes available.
I just received it today in the mail and activated it.
For those interested, I have been able to continue using the QuickSilver card. However, the rewards changed from the 1.5% cash back to reward points from the moment the product change occurred.

@Boribori I had the Platinum for six months when I tried the "/productupgrade" trick and was advised of the possibility of the QuickSilver. That was January, 2022. I had the QuickSilver for six+ months when I again tried the "/productupgrade" trick and was advised of the possibility of the Venture One. That was a week ago or so!
